What is Steel Wool?
Steel wool is essentially a mass of very fine, flexible steel fibers. These fibers are produced by a process similar to shaving, where a rotating drum with cutting teeth removes thin strands from a steel billet. The resulting steel wool is then sorted and graded based on the coarseness of the fibers.
Understanding Steel Wool Grades
The grading system for steel wool indicates the fineness or coarseness of the strands. The grades range from extra coarse to extra fine, each suited for different applications. Here’s a breakdown:
- Extra Coarse (Grade 4): Used for heavy-duty stripping, such as removing paint or varnish from wood or metal.
- Coarse (Grade 3): Suitable for rough cleaning, aggressive rust removal, and preparing surfaces for painting.
- Medium (Grade 2): A general-purpose grade for cleaning, scrubbing, and removing stubborn grime.
- Medium Fine (Grade 1): Ideal for smoothing surfaces, removing light rust, and preparing surfaces for finishing.
- Fine (Grade 0): Used for polishing, buffing, and applying wax or finishes.
- Extra Fine (Grade 00, 000, 0000): The finest grades are used for delicate polishing, removing fine scratches, and applying a final sheen to surfaces. Grade 0000 is often used by antique restorers to polish delicate finishes without damaging them.
Common Uses of Steel Wool
The versatility of steel wool stems from its ability to conform to different shapes and surfaces, making it ideal for a wide array of tasks:
Cleaning and Polishing
Steel wool is effective for cleaning various surfaces, including metal, glass, and wood. It can remove rust, tarnish, and water spots from metal surfaces. When used with appropriate cleaning agents, it can also clean glass and ceramic surfaces without scratching. For wood, finer grades of steel wool can be used to polish and prepare surfaces for finishing.
Surface Preparation
Before painting or staining, steel wool can be used to lightly scuff surfaces, creating a better bond for the finish. This is particularly useful for glossy surfaces that may not readily accept paint or stain. Always ensure the surface is clean and free of debris after using steel wool.
Wood Finishing
Steel wool is a favorite among woodworkers for applying and buffing finishes. Fine grades can be used to apply wax or oil finishes, while extra fine grades can be used to buff the finish to a smooth, lustrous sheen. The flexibility of steel wool allows it to conform to intricate carvings and moldings.
Automotive Applications
In automotive detailing, steel wool can be used to clean and polish chrome surfaces, remove rust spots, and prepare surfaces for painting. However, extreme caution should be exercised to avoid scratching the paint. Only the finest grades should be used, and always with plenty of lubricant.
Pest Control
Steel wool can be used to fill small holes and cracks to prevent rodents and insects from entering buildings. Rodents find it difficult to chew through steel wool, making it an effective barrier. It’s important to combine this method with other pest control strategies for comprehensive protection.
Safety Precautions When Using Steel Wool
While steel wool is a useful tool, it’s essential to take safety precautions to avoid injury and ensure proper usage:
- Wear Gloves: Steel wool can cause cuts and splinters. Wearing gloves protects your hands from injury.
- Eye Protection: Small fragments of steel wool can break off and fly into your eyes. Always wear safety glasses or goggles to protect your eyes.
- Ventilation: When using steel wool with solvents or finishes, work in a well-ventilated area to avoid inhaling harmful fumes.
- Fire Hazard: Steel wool is flammable, especially when coated with oil or solvents. Keep it away from open flames and sources of ignition. Dispose of used steel wool properly in a non-flammable container.
- Rusting: Steel wool can rust easily, especially when exposed to moisture. Store it in a dry place to prevent rusting.
Alternatives to Steel Wool
While steel wool is a valuable tool, there are alternatives that may be more suitable for certain applications:
- Synthetic Steel Wool (Nylon Abrasive Pads): These pads are made from synthetic fibers impregnated with abrasive particles. They are less likely to rust and can be used with water-based finishes without causing discoloration.
- Sandpaper: Sandpaper is a versatile abrasive material that comes in a wide range of grits. It’s suitable for sanding wood, metal, and plastic.
- Abrasive Sponges: These sponges are coated with abrasive particles and are useful for cleaning and scrubbing various surfaces.
- Scouring Pads: Scouring pads are typically made from synthetic fibers and are used for cleaning and scrubbing household surfaces.
Steel Wool vs. Other Abrasives
Steel wool offers unique advantages compared to other abrasives. Its flexibility allows it to conform to complex shapes, making it ideal for intricate work. It also tends to produce a smoother finish than sandpaper, especially on wood. However, steel wool can leave behind fine steel fibers, which can cause problems with certain finishes. Choosing the Right Steel Wool Grade for Your Project
Selecting the correct steel wool grade is crucial for achieving the desired results. Consider the following factors:
- Surface Material: Different materials require different grades of steel wool. Softer materials like wood require finer grades, while harder materials like metal can tolerate coarser grades.
- Desired Finish: If you’re aiming for a smooth, polished finish, use finer grades of steel wool. For aggressive stripping or cleaning, use coarser grades.
- Type of Finish: Some finishes, such as water-based finishes, can react with steel fibers, causing discoloration. In these cases, use synthetic steel wool or other alternatives.

Proper Disposal of Steel Wool
Proper disposal of steel wool is important to prevent fire hazards and environmental contamination. Here are some guidelines:
- Used Steel Wool with Oil or Solvents: Place used steel wool in a non-flammable container, such as a metal can with a lid. Fill the container with water to prevent spontaneous combustion. Dispose of the container according to local regulations for hazardous waste.
- Clean Steel Wool: Clean steel wool can be recycled with other scrap metal. Check with your local recycling center for specific guidelines.
- Rusting Steel Wool: Rusting steel wool should be disposed of properly to prevent further contamination. Place it in a sealed bag and dispose of it with your regular trash.
Advanced Techniques Using Steel Wool
Beyond basic cleaning and polishing, steel wool can be used for more advanced techniques:
Distressing Wood
Steel wool can be used to create a distressed or aged look on wood surfaces. By lightly rubbing the wood with steel wool, you can soften sharp edges and create a worn appearance. This technique is popular in furniture making and home decor.
Creating Special Effects on Metal
Steel wool can be used to create unique textures and patterns on metal surfaces. By using different grades and techniques, you can achieve a variety of effects, from a brushed finish to a swirling pattern.
Removing Stubborn Residue
Steel wool can be surprisingly effective at removing stubborn residue from various surfaces. From adhesive residue to paint splatters, steel wool can help you tackle tough cleaning challenges. Always test a small, inconspicuous area first to ensure that the steel wool doesn’t damage the surface.
